Police ask for help in locating missing Flintshire teen

North Wales Police have put an appeal out on social media asking for help in locating a 14-year-old girl from the Hawarden / Northop area’s.

Jasmine Toye is described as being 5ft 3in’s tall and of medium build.

Jasmine has blonde hair.

If you have seen her or know her wearbaout police are asking yo to call 101 quoting Itrace 19196
